Monte Rocca di Cavrenno
Monte Rocca di Cavrenno is a peak in Firenzuola, Florence, Tuscany and has an elevation of 866 metres. Monte Rocca di Cavrenno is situated nearby to the hamlet Ca‘ Nove, as well as near Montalbano.Photo: Naioli, CC BY-SA 4.0.

Raticosa pass
Mountain saddle
Photo: Christianlorenz97,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Raticosa pass is a mountain pass in the Tuscan-Emilian Apennines with an elevation of 968 m above sea level. It is located close to the small town of Pietramala in the municipality of Firenzuola, which forms part of the Metropolitan City of Florence.
